Electrostatic oil smoke purifier with automatic cleaning filter
Technical Field
The utility model relates to the field of electrostatic oil fume purifiers, in particular to an electrostatic oil fume purifier with an automatic cleaning filter.
Background
The fume purifier refers to a fume exhaust gas treatment device. The oil fume purifier is mainly used for purifying and treating low-altitude oil fume discharged from a kitchen; used in hotels, restaurants, dining rooms, schools, institutions, factories and other places; food frying and cooking industries; oil splash heat treatment workshop, oil mist lubrication workshop, workpiece welding workshop, and olefin oil boiler discharge. The Chinese patent discloses an automatic cleaning filter electrostatic oil smoke clarifier (grant bulletin number CN 210474306U), and this patent technology discloses an automatic cleaning filter electrostatic oil smoke clarifier, which comprises a housin, the inside upper end of casing is fixedly provided with first electrode plate, the inside lower extreme of casing is fixedly provided with the second electrode plate, the inside upper end of casing and lower extreme both sides surface all set up the installation piece, the activity is provided with the filter screen between the installation piece inside, the activity interlude is provided with the dead lever between the installation piece, dead lever one end is fixed and is provided with the rubber buffer, the dead lever is kept away from the fixed pull ring that is provided with of one end of rubber buffer, the fixed base that is provided with in casing lower extreme surface four corners department, the fixed rings that are provided with in casing upper end surface four corners department, the fixed flange that is provided with in casing both sides. The utility model has better use effect and can be convenient for disassembling and assembling the filter screen for filtering the oil smoke, thereby being convenient for cleaning and processing the filter screen. The oil smoke clarifier of present use its filter screen has been solved to this patent technique and has been inconvenient to change after long-term use washs the maintenance, and mostly is through the screw continuously fixed, if still there is rusty possibility for a long time, leads to the filter screen to be difficult to be dismantled the problem that influences the result of use.
However, in the electrostatic soot cleaners of the prior art, the electric field of the filter is usually installed inside the housing, and it is necessary to periodically clean the oil dirt remaining in the electric field.
The problem of residual greasy dirt in the self-cleaning electric field needs to be solved.
Accordingly, a person skilled in the art provides an electrostatic type fume purifier with a self-cleaning filter to solve the above-mentioned problems in the background art.

Example 1
Referring to fig. 1 to 5, in this embodiment, an electrostatic oil smoke purifier with a self-cleaning filter is provided, which includes: a housing mechanism 1; the shell mechanism 1 comprises a shell body 101, wherein one end of the shell body 101 is provided with a first side cover 102 in a sealing manner, and the other end of the shell body 101 is provided with a second side cover 103 in a sealing manner; the bottom of the outer shell 101 is provided with a first drainage hopper 104 in a penetrating and sealing manner, and the bottom of the second side cover 103 is provided with a second drainage hopper 105 in a penetrating and sealing manner; a box body 108 is arranged below the outer shell 101, a first electromagnetic valve 106 is arranged at the bottom of the first drainage hopper 104, and the first drainage hopper 104 is connected to the inside of the box body 108 through the first electromagnetic valve 106; the bottom of the second drainage bucket 105 is provided with a second electromagnetic valve 107, and the second drainage bucket 105 is connected to the inside of the box 108 through the second electromagnetic valve 107; the front side of the box body 108 is provided with a discharge port 109 in a penetrating way, and the rear side of the box body 108 is provided with a water inlet pipe in a penetrating way; a flushing plate 110 is arranged in the side cover I102, and a pump body 111 is connected with water supply at the bottom end of the flushing plate 110; the pumping end of the pump body 111 is connected to the inside of the box 108 in a sealing and penetrating way; the side wall of the first side cover 102 is provided with a smoke inlet pipe 112 in a sealing and penetrating way; one end of the second side cover 103 is provided with a smoke outlet pipe 113 in a sealing and penetrating way; the electric field filter 3 is arranged in the outer shell 101, the electric field filter 3 is electrically connected with the electric controller 2, and the electric controller 2 is arranged on the outer wall of the outer shell 101;
the tank 108 serves to store the washing water and collect the washed waste water;
when the electric field filter 3 in the outer shell 101 is cleaned;
introducing and storing a water source containing alkalinity into the box 108 through a water inlet pipe, starting a pump body 111 (a first electromagnetic valve 106 and a second electromagnetic valve 107 are in a closed state), and assembling a smoke inlet pipe 112 and a smoke outlet pipe 113 with sealing electromagnetic valves, wherein the inner space of the outer shell 101 is in a closed state;
the pump body 111 starts to discharge the water source in the box 108 into the outer shell 101 through the side cover one 102 so as to soak the electric field filter 3;
after the electric field filter 3 is soaked, opening the first electromagnetic valve 106 and the second electromagnetic valve 107, discharging a water source in the outer shell 101 into the box 108, discharging wastewater through the discharge port 109, placing water added with cleaning liquid into the box 108, starting the pump body 111 again, flushing the electric field filter 3 through the flushing plate 110 by the pump body 111, and discharging the flushed water flow from the outer shell 101 through the first drainage hopper 104 and the second drainage hopper 105;
after the electric field filter 3 is cleaned, the ventilation operation of the smoke exhaust ventilator is started, and the interior of the outer shell 101 is ventilated and dried.
